Continuing with the ED-209 Project, the latest parts are the elbow flap, and the Thigh piece I think is the best description.
I managed to cast the elbow flap as one solid piece without having to glue it together afterward using a technique I saw on How It's Made which I call enclosed casting. it probably has a proper name but I don't know what it is.
I have settled, for now, on Vacuum Forming the Thigh as its a large part and I have the machine now, though it's fairly easy to make one yourself.
